The interview process was incredibly thorough. They really want to make sure they are picking the absolute best candidate to fill their positions.
I completed four rounds of interviews in total. The first was a quick phone call with a recruiter. This is where expectations were set, as well as the next steps.
The second interview was with the hiring manager and felt more like a conversation than an interview. Usual interview questions were asked like "Why are you looking to join TDX?" an explanation of skills and experience, etc.
The next interview was a presentation given to a selected panel. They really just want to get a feel for who you are as a person as opposed to your knowledge.
Finally, you interview with a senior leadership member.
My interview was done remotely over various mediums.

Initial conversation with a recruiter followed by completing the CCAT and then conversations and interviews with the hiring manager and executive leadership. For this role I was asked to prepare a short presentation on something that I was interested in and I presented that to the same individuals listed above.
